Genel bilgiler
19. yüzyılın ortalarında Londra'daki Westminster Sarayı'nın yeniden inşasındaki rolüyle tanınan, aynı zamanda diğer birçok bina ve bahçeden de sorumlu olan İngiliz bir mimardı. Britanya'da İtalyan mimarisinin kullanımına yaptığı büyük katkılarla tanınır.
